Fairing on my R-90 broke at one  of the four fastener points.  I see no fiberglass, it's smooth inside and thin, so I assume plastic.

You can patch ABS nicely by melting other ABS in acetone and using fibreglass mesh (aka "drywall patch tape")  as a structural agent. I use a rasp/file on a chunk of ABS pipe to get shavings and then mix in acetone until I have goo that's about the consistency I want.

I did just use jb weld on two tabs for a Vino side cover.

Haven't put it back on the scooter yet but it seems decently strong.

I used the stuff that takes four hours to set then 16 to cure ( app. )

Had to use painters tape to hold it in place initially. Maybe the quicker setting stuff wouldn't need that?

It was the twin plunger set up with the sealing cap.
